1 Reel Elves

One reel. Single vertical column. Spinomenal stripped away the extra reels. You set your bet. The reel spins. Symbols land. Payouts trigger. No paylines to track. No multiple reels to coordinate. direct spinning and results.

Frequently Asked Questions

How does the single-reel format in 1 Reel Elves differ from traditional multi-reel slots?

1 Reel Elves uses a vertical reel with a single spinning column instead of multiple reels. Symbol combinations trigger payouts based on matching outcomes across the reel's positions, eliminating the complexity of traditional payline structures found in standard slots.

Can I adjust my bet size in 1 Reel Elves?

Yes. You control stake size through standard coin value and bet level adjustments built into the game, allowing you to calibrate your wager within the game's available range.

What makes 1 Reel Elves unique compared to other slot games?

The game strips away traditional payline complexity by using a single-reel format with vertical spin mechanics. This straightforward spin-and-result gameplay centers on symbol-based payouts rather than complex payline combinations.

How does the symbol-based payout structure work in this game?

Payouts trigger when matching symbols land across the reel's positions. The single-reel design uses this symbol combination mechanic instead of the multi-reel, multi-payline systems found in conventional slots.
